kotlin-lib-mcp
MCP server (Kotlin Multiplatform) that, on request, downloads the sources of a
Maven-published Kotlin/Java library (e.g. io.ktor:ktor-client-core:3.5.1) and exposes
structured information about it — public API surface, KDoc, dependencies/metadata, and raw
source + search — to MCP clients (Claude Code, Claude Desktop, …). An optional Compose
Desktop dashboard runs the same server in-process for control, logs, and cache browsing.
Modules
core/— KMP library: domain model + use cases, no MCP and no UI.commonMain: model (LibraryCoordinate,ApiSymbol,KDoc,DependencyNode, …) and interfaces (MavenSourceFetcher,SourceAnalyzer,LibraryCache).jvmMain: JVM implementations —MavenSourceFetcher(Ktor client +.module/.pomparsing),ZipExtractor,AnalysisApiSourceAnalyzer, on-disk cache.
server/— JVM app: registers MCP tools and runs the transports. Runnable headless.dashboard/— Compose Desktop control panel (optional). Embedsserver.tools/— asset generator, never shipped: the SEP-973 icon PNGs. Its output does ship —server/src/main/resources/icons/is read byicons/Icons.ktand rides inline in everytools/list— so the glyph geometry inGenerateIcons.ktis product source, not repo artwork. Nothing depends on the module;./gradlew buildcompiles it only so it cannot rot../gradlew :tools:generateIcons.
server and dashboard both depend on core. server runs without Compose.
Not a Gradle module: plugin/ — the Claude Code plugin packaging (.mcp.json pinning the
GHCR image to its <major>.<minor> tag, plus four skills), listed by the repo-root
.claude-plugin/marketplace.json so /plugin marketplace add aoreshkov/kotlin-lib-mcp works.
Validate with claude plugin validate ./plugin --strict; the image pin and the plugin's own
version are bumped by the /release skill on minor releases.
Build & run
./gradlew build # build all modules
./gradlew test # unit tests
./gradlew :server:run --args="--transport stdio" # local MCP (default)
./gradlew :server:run --args="--transport http --port 3000" # Streamable HTTP
./gradlew :dashboard:run # Compose Desktop UI
